Kids are out of school & summer is underway! Our Farmers Market will open this Saturday, June 4 & will kickoff with a 5K race. Hours will be 8 a.m. to 12 noon. Space is still available for vendors; if interested please contact the Chamber at (706) 597-1000.
Freedom Blast is back on the calendar for Friday, July 1st beginning at 7 p.m. We'll have a fireworks show at the Thomson-McDuffie Government Complex front lawn with numerous vendors & activities for the kids.
The Chamber, along with Shaw Industries, would also like to recognize the "Patriots of McDuffie County" during the Freedom Blast. These are heroes that represent everything our Founding Fathers fought for during the Revolutionary War. This includes all Military branches, Fire Fighters, Emergency Medical Services and Police Department. Freedom Blast is a time to celebrate our Independence, but also recognize those that put their lives in danger to protect our freedom.
Please contact the Chamber of Commerce to register to attend so we can give special recognition to those individuals.

he annual Blind Willie McTell Blues Festival was held on May 7, 2016 and was a huge success! One first time attendee stopped by the visitor booth to say it was "the friendliest festival he had ever been to!" What a great compliment to all of the organizers of the event! Have you ever wondered how far away some attendees travel for this event? Here are some of the locations people traveled the farthest to attend:
Madison, Wisconsin
Pearland, Texas
Breinigsville, Pennsylvania
Annapolis, Maryland
Pensacola, Florida
Lynchburg, Virginia
Nashville, Tennessee
